Candidates contesting the Renfrewshire West and Levern Valley constituency are making their final push ahead of polling day on Thursday 7th May 2026.

The SNP’s Tom Arthur is seeking to retain the seat. He was first elected in 2016 and re-elected in 2021, and has served as Minister for Public Finance, Planning and Community Wealth.

His campaign has focused on the cost of living and access to services, including plans to expand the £2 bus fare cap and increase the number of GP walk-in centres. He has also backed support for first-time buyers and wider proposals set out by the SNP ahead of the election.

Scottish Labour candidate Paul O’Kane has said the Royal Alexandra Hospital will be a key priority in his campaign.

He said reducing waiting times, improving access to GPs and using new technology to speed up diagnosis and treatment would be central to Labour’s plans for the NHS.

Scottish Conservative candidate Farooq Choudhry is contesting the seat, representing the party’s campaign on lower taxes, economic growth and public services.

Scottish Liberal Democrat candidate Ross Stalker has previously stood in the area and has highlighted issues including mental health and the cost of living.

He has said he wants to see action to reduce living costs and improve public services, as well as a focus on fairness and support for local communities.

Reform UK candidate Jamie McGuire has been campaigning on housing and economic growth.

He said he supports building 15,000 social homes a year and reducing planning restrictions to increase housing supply, arguing this would help more people get onto the housing ladder. He has also called for lower taxes and measures to support economic growth.

Alliance for Democracy and Freedom candidate Ken Thomson is a former senior Scottish Government civil servant who served as director-general for strategy and external affairs.

He has said he wants to see stronger economic growth, lower taxes and improvements in public services including education and healthcare, and has criticised the performance of the Scottish Parliament since its creation.

With polling day approaching, voters will choose between candidates from across the political spectrum as they decide who will represent Renfrewshire West and Levern Valley at Holyrood.
